Simple Mobile Houston TX
Add Website
Close
Simple Mobile
Be first to review 11581 S Wilcrest Dr,Houston TX 77099 Phone Number: (281) 575-7601
Simple Mobile Store Hours
Hours may fluctuate
Post a review
Simple Mobile Nearby
Locations Closest to You miles-
Simple Mobile - Houston 10550 W Bellfort0.38
-
Simple Mobile - Houston 10470 W Bellfort0.51
-
Simple Mobile - Stafford 11210 W Airport Blvd0.70